Stonework installation services involve the skilled placement and construction of stone features on residential properties. This process can include building stone patios, walkways, retaining walls, garden borders, and decorative accents. Professionals in this field work with a variety of natural stones, such as flagstone, limestone, granite, and slate, to create durable and visually appealing outdoor features. Proper installation ensures that these structures are stable, long-lasting, and resistant to weathering, enhancing both the function and the aesthetic of a property.

These services often address common problems homeowners face with their outdoor spaces. For example, uneven or cracked concrete surfaces may be replaced with natural stone to improve safety and appearance. Retaining walls built by experienced contractors can help manage soil erosion and prevent landscape shifting, especially on sloped properties. Additionally, installing a stone pathway can reduce muddy or slippery areas, making outdoor navigation safer and more attractive. Stonework can also serve as a low-maintenance solution that withstands the elements better than other materials.

Many types of properties benefit from stonework installation, including single-family homes, multi-unit residential complexes, and even some commercial properties. Homes with yards that feature uneven terrain or areas prone to erosion often see the greatest improvements with stone features. Properties that aim to increase curb appeal or create inviting outdoor living spaces frequently choose stone for its natural beauty and durability. Whether for a small garden border or a large outdoor patio, professional stonework installation can provide a practical and attractive upgrade to residential exteriors.

The overview below groups typical Stonework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or stonework repairs often range from $250-$600, covering tasks like fixing cracks or replacing small sections.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ials used.

Patio and Walkway Installations - installing new stone patios or walkways generally costs between $1,500-$4,000 for standard projects. Larger, more intricate designs or premium materials can push costs higher, but most projects remain within this range.

Retaining Walls - building a retaining wall can vary from $2,000-$8,000 depending on length, height, and complexity. Many projects are completed in the lower to mid part of this range, with more complex or taller walls reaching into higher costs.

Full Stonework Replacement - complete replacement of existing stone features or structures can range from $5,000 to $20,000 or more for larger, custom projects. Most projects in this category tend to cluster around the mid to high end, depending on size and design details.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of stonework installation services do local contractors offer? Local contractors typically provide services such as patio and walkway installation, retaining wall construction, fireplace and fire pit building, and decorative stone features for landscaping projects.

How can I ensure the stonework matches the style of my property? Consulting with experienced local service providers can help select stone types, colors, and designs that complement the existing architecture and landscape of the property.

Are there different materials used for stonework installation? Yes, local pros work with a variety of materials including natural stone, brick, and manufactured stone, allowing for customization based on aesthetic preferences and functional needs.

What preparations are needed before stonework installation begins? Typically, site clearing, leveling, and foundation preparation are required, and local contractors can advise on specific steps based on the project scope.
